Add script to update local snapshots from CI (#5816)

It seems like the thresholds are too low for all tests to pass when
snapshots are generated from windows / linux. We need a better solution
to this problem, but in the meantime this script should allow
contributors to update their snapshots by downloading them from the last
CI run.

You can test your code locally by running `./scripts/check.sh`.
There are snapshots test that might need to be updated.
Run the tests with `UPDATE_SNAPSHOTS=true cargo test --workspace --all-features` to update all of them.
If CI keeps complaining about snapshots (which could happen if you don't use macOS, snapshots in CI are currently
rendered with macOS), you can instead run `./scripts/update_snapshots_from_ci.sh` to update your local snapshots from
the last CI run of your PR (which will download the `test_results` artefact).
For more info about the tests see [egui_kittest](./crates/egui_kittest/README.md).

#!/usr/bin/env bash
# This script searches for the last CI run with your branch name, downloads the test_results artefact
# and replaces your existing snapshots with the new ones.
# Make sure you have the gh cli installed and authenticated before running this script.
set -eu
BRANCH=$(git rev-parse --abbrev-ref HEAD)
RUN_ID=$(gh run list --branch "$BRANCH" --workflow "Rust" --json databaseId -q '.[0].databaseId')
ECHO "Downloading test results from run $RUN_ID from branch $BRANCH"
# remove any existing .new.png that might have been left behind
find . -type d -path "*/tests/snapshots*" | while read dir; do
find "$dir" -type f -name "*.new.png" | while read file; do
rm "$file"
done
done
gh run download "$RUN_ID" --name "test-results" --dir tmp_artefacts
# move the snapshots to the correct location, overwriting the existing ones
rsync -a tmp_artefacts/ .
rm -r tmp_artefacts
# rename the .new.png files to .png
find . -type d -path "*/tests/snapshots*" | while read dir; do
find "$dir" -type f -name "*.new.png" | while read file; do
mv -f "$file" "${file%.new.png}.png"
done
done
echo "Done!"
